Kamui by Siter Skain. One of the best dojin shmups but it's no longer sold so it can be tough to find a full version.

Everything from Shanhai Alice(Zun): Embodiement of Scarlet Devil, Perfect Cherry Blossom, Imperishable Night, and Shoot the Bullet. Stunning manic/barrage style shooters. The boss battles are simply stunning. Great soundtracks are also a plus.

Samidare. Doesn't get the buzz it deserves but it's fantastic.

Hitogata Happa. Another vertical manic shoot em up. Murasame makes some amazing games and Hitogata is his best.

That's a pretty good sampling of the genre but there are tons of great japanese shoot em ups out there. Best place to find links to the demos is probably shoot the core, http://shootthecore.moonpod.com/PClinks1.html

Anything by Kenta Cho is good (just Google).

rRootage and Torus Trooper are probably his best efforts.

Parsec47 is an excellent tribute to Cave's arcade game Dangun Feveron. Try out Dangun if you ever get the chance. The best disco shoot em up ever!
